The Unseen Influences: Weather, City, and Beyond

Furthermore, external factors heavily influence stadium construction. Weather patterns, city regulations, and even local cultural nuances play a significant role. For example, stadiums in colder climates require sophisticated heating systems. So, the design must accommodate extreme weather conditions. In contrast, stadiums in sunnier regions may prioritize shade and ventilation. Also, consider the impact of public transportation or local infrastructure.

4. Predicting the Rush: Concession Sales and Crowd Control

Ever wonder why your favorite beer seems to always be cold, or why the lines at halftime move so (relatively) fast? AI. Algorithms analyze historical data, weather patterns, and even social media trends to predict peak demand for concessions. Simultaneously, AI-powered systems manage crowd flow, optimizing entry points and preventing bottlenecks. It's a constant game of chess, played with data points, to keep us happy and spending.

The Unseen Costs of Concrete Cathedrals

Forget the highlight reels for a moment. We're beginning our exploration by peering into the financial underbelly of these colossal structures. Our AI, equipped with advanced predictive modeling, has uncovered hidden costs that often remain obscured beneath the veneer of grandeur. For instance, the seemingly straightforward task of maintaining the playing surface. While the luscious green fields appear pristine on game day, the reality is far more complex. The intricate interplay of drainage systems, irrigation, and specialized turf management is a constant, resource-intensive battle. Athena has calculated that the average annual cost of maintaining a natural grass field in an NFL stadium hovers around $500,000, a figure that can fluctuate wildly based on weather conditions and the intensity of the season. Artificial turf, while initially cheaper, presents its own unique set of challenges. The long-term expenses associated with replacing the synthetic surface, dealing with the environmental impact of discarded materials, and managing the heat retention issues, frequently push the overall lifecycle costs far higher than initial projections suggest. Furthermore, Athena's analysis has revealed that the true cost of stadium construction extends far beyond the headline figures. Taxpayer subsidies, infrastructure improvements, and the hidden expenses of land acquisition often inflate the actual financial burden – a fact rarely disclosed with full transparency.

The Stadium Experience: A Digital Transformation

The fan experience in the 21st century is no longer defined by mere attendance. It's about seamless digital integration. Athena's deep dive examined the technological infrastructure of each stadium, revealing a fascinating spectrum of capabilities and shortcomings. The most advanced venues offer a truly immersive experience: high-definition video boards, lightning-fast Wi-Fi, and interactive mobile apps that go far beyond simple ticketing and merchandise sales. However, many stadiums still lag behind, plagued by spotty Wi-Fi, outdated concession systems, and a lack of real-time information for fans. The implementation of 5G connectivity has proven to be a key differentiator. Athena identified a distinct correlation between robust 5G infrastructure and enhanced fan satisfaction, particularly among younger, digitally native audiences. Furthermore, the analysis found that the adoption of beacon technology, enabling personalized notifications and location-based services, is rapidly gaining traction in creating hyper-personalized fan experiences. The integration of mobile ordering systems has streamlined concession sales and reduced wait times. Athena's research highlights the disparity between stadiums that embrace digital innovation and those that remain tethered to outdated systems, showing that technology is not merely an add-on, but an essential component of the modern football experience.
